| Chemical Type | Complex metal oxide (Fe–Cr–Ni spinel-based) |
| Product Form | Wet-filtered, moisture-stabilized cake (~35–40% residual moisture) |
| Appearance | Uniform dark brown to black granular sand-like mass |
| Primary Applications | Ceramics, architectural concrete, refractories, terrazzo |
| Key Features | Heat-resistant, alkali-stable, low solubility, dispersible in water |
| Benefits | Consistent batch-to-batch color, reduced settling, no VOC contribution |
| pH (10% slurry) | 7.2–8.0 |
| Storage Stability | 12 months in sealed container at 5–30 °C |
